THE RFU have taken action in the High Court against former England international Victor Ubogu and VU Ltd – his hospitality company.
The RFU have obtained a permanent injunction which prevents Ubogu and VU Ltd from operating unofficial ticketed hospitality for England matches played at Twickenham in the future.
Ubogu and VU Ltd have agreed to pay damages which will be reinvested into the sport and the RFU’s legal expenses.
They have also agreed to divulge the sources of their tickets.
“We are very clear about our ticketing terms and conditions and they are explicitly stated on every ticket,” said RFU chief executive Steve Brown.
“We need to be quite firm about that.”
